    Jennifer Marie Morrison, born on April 12, 1979, in Chicago, Illinois, is an American actress, director, and producer. She gained prominence portraying Dr. Allison Cameron on the medical drama House (2004–2012) and Emma Swan on ABC’s fantasy series Once Upon a Time (2011–2018). Morrison has also appeared in notable roles such as Zoey Pierson in How I Met Your Mother, Winona Kirk in Star Trek (2009), and Tess Conlon in Warrior (2011).​

    Raised in Arlington Heights, Illinois, Morrison is the eldest of three children. She attended Prospect High School, where she was active in music and cheerleading, and later graduated from Loyola University Chicago with a degree in theater and English. She further honed her craft at the Steppenwolf Theatre Company before moving to Los Angeles to pursue acting.​

    In 2017, Morrison made her directorial debut with the film Sun Dogs. She has been in a relationship with actor Gerardo Celasco since 2019, and in June 2024, she announced the birth of their daughter.

    Saoirse Ronan, born on April 12, 1994, in The Bronx, New York, is an Irish-American actress acclaimed for her nuanced performances in both period dramas and contemporary films. She moved to Ireland at age three and began acting in her early teens.

    Her breakout role came at 13 in Atonement (2007), earning her an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actress. Ronan has since received four Oscar nominations for her roles in Brooklyn (2015), Lady Bird (2017), and Little Women (2019). Known for her versatility, she has also starred in The Lovely Bones and Hanna. In 2024, she produced and starred in The Outrun, portraying a woman recovering from addiction.

    Ronan has expressed interest in directing, inspired by her collaborations with filmmakers like Greta Gerwig. She is married to Scottish actor Jack Lowden, and together they co-founded the production company Arcade Pictures. Ronan continues to be celebrated for her compelling portrayals and contributions to cinema.

    Tulsi Gabbard, born on April 12, 1981, in Leloaloa, American Samoa, is an American politician and military officer. She made history as the first Hindu and Samoan American elected to the U.S. Congress, representing Hawaii’s 2nd district from 2013 to 2021.

    A combat veteran, Gabbard served in the Hawaii Army National Guard and was deployed to Iraq and Kuwait, attaining the rank of lieutenant colonel in the U.S. Army Reserve. Initially a Democrat, she ran for president in 2020 but later left the party in 2022, citing ideological differences. In 2024, she joined the Republican Party and endorsed Donald Trump.

    In February 2025, Gabbard was confirmed as the Director of National Intelligence, becoming the youngest person and first Pacific Islander American to hold the position. Her political journey reflects a shift from progressive to conservative stances, emphasizing non-interventionist foreign policy and national security.

    Vincent Kompany, born April 10, 1986, in Uccle, Belgium, is a former professional footballer and current manager. He began his playing career with Anderlecht before moving to Hamburger SV in 2006. In 2008, Kompany joined Manchester City, where he became a pivotal figure, captaining the team to four Premier League titles.

    Internationally, he earned 89 caps for Belgium, participating in multiple European Championships and World Cups. After retiring as a player, Kompany transitioned into management, leading Anderlecht and later Burnley. In May 2024, he was appointed head coach of Bayern Munich, signing a contract until June 2027. Kompany holds an MBA from Manchester Business School, reflecting his commitment to both athletic and academic pursuits.

    Chyler Leigh, born Chyler Leigh Potts on April 10, 1982, in Charlotte, North Carolina, is an American actress, singer, and model. She began her career in modeling and local television commercials before transitioning to acting.

    Leigh gained early recognition for her role as Janey Briggs in the parody film “Not Another Teen Movie” (2001). She achieved widespread acclaim portraying Dr. Lexie Grey on ABC’s medical drama “Grey’s Anatomy” from 2007 to 2012. From 2015 to 2021, she starred as Alex Danvers in the superhero series “Supergirl,” a role she reprised in crossover events across the Arrowverse.

    In 2023, Leigh began co-starring with Andie MacDowell in the Hallmark series “The Way Home.” Beyond acting, she collaborates musically with her husband, Nathan West, under the name “WestLeigh.” Leigh has been open about her past struggles with drug addiction and credits her recovery to her faith and family support.

    Sadio Mané, born April 10, 1992, in Bambali, Senegal, is a professional footballer renowned for his speed, technique, and goal-scoring prowess. He began his professional career with Metz in France before moving to Red Bull Salzburg in Austria, where he won a domestic double in the 2013–14 season.

    In 2014, Mané joined Southampton in the English Premier League, setting a record for the fastest hat-trick in league history. His exceptional performances led to a transfer to Liverpool in 2016, where he became a key figure in the team’s success, winning the UEFA Champions League in 2019 and the Premier League in 2020. In 2022, he transferred to Bayern Munich, contributing to their domestic campaigns.

    Internationally, Mané has been instrumental for the Senegal national team, becoming their all-time top scorer and leading them to victory in the 2021 Africa Cup of Nations. Off the pitch, he is known for his philanthropic efforts, including funding infrastructure projects in his hometown.

    Daisy Jazz Isobel Ridley, born April 10, 1992, in London, England, is an English actress best known for her role as Rey in the “Star Wars” sequel trilogy. She studied at the Tring Park School for the Performing Arts, graduating in 2010.

    Ridley began her acting career with appearances in British television series such as “Youngers,” “Silent Witness,” “Mr Selfridge,” and “Casualty.” In 2014, she was cast as Rey in “Star Wars: Episode VII – The Force Awakens” (2015), a role she reprised in “The Last Jedi” (2017) and “The Rise of Skywalker” (2019).

    Beyond “Star Wars,” Ridley has appeared in films like “Murder on the Orient Express” (2017) and “Chaos Walking” (2021). In 2024, she portrayed Gertrude Ederle, the first woman to swim across the English Channel, in the biographical film “Young Woman and the Sea.

    Haley Joel Osment, born April 10, 1988, in Los Angeles, California, is an American actor who began his career as a child.

    He gained early recognition with a role in “Forrest Gump” (1994) and starred in “The Sixth Sense” (1999), earning an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actor. Osment also appeared in “Pay It Forward” (2000) and “A.I. Artificial Intelligence” (2001).

    After attending New York University’s Tisch School of the Arts, he took on diverse roles in film, television, and voice acting, including the “Kingdom Hearts” video game series. His recent work includes appearances in “Future Man” (2017–2020) and “The Boys” (2020).

    Steven Frederic Seagal, born April 10, 1952, in Lansing, Michigan, is an American actor, martial artist, and musician. He began his martial arts journey under Fumio Demura and later moved to Japan at 17 to teach English and study Zen, earning black belts in aikido, karate, judo, and kendo.

    Seagal became the first American to operate an aikido dojo in Japan. Transitioning to Hollywood, he made his acting debut in “Above the Law” (1988) and gained fame with “Under Siege” (1992). Beyond acting, Seagal is a guitarist with two albums: “Songs from the Crystal Cave” (2004) and “Mojo Priest” (2006).

    He has faced multiple sexual harassment allegations since 1991. Politically, Seagal supports Vladimir Putin, obtaining Russian citizenship in 2016 and serving as Russia’s special envoy to the U.S. since 2018.
